The average 1997 HONDA ACTY has 41,335 miles on the clock, which is significantly below the expected 214,600 miles for a 29-year-old car. Low-mileage examples may have spent time sitting unused, so check for issues like corroded brakes or perished rubber seals.

Common Issues to Watch For

Based on the 1997 HONDA ACTY's fuel type, age, and engine size, these are the most likely problem areas to check.

Coil Pack Failure

Medium risk

Smaller petrol engines are prone to ignition coil failures, causing misfires and rough running. Replacement is £50-£150 per coil.

Rust and Corrosion

Watch out

At 10+ years, check wheel arches, sills, subframe, and brake lines for rust. Structural corrosion is an MOT failure. Prevention is far cheaper than repair.

Suspension Bushings

Watch out

Rubber suspension bushes harden and crack with age, causing knocking noises and vague handling. A full refresh costs £300-£800 depending on the car.

Service History

Low risk

Always request a full service history. Regular servicing is the single best indicator of how well a car has been maintained, regardless of mileage.
